Сложение текстовых значений в цикле

1. M0h 03.06.24 09:33 Сейчас в теме
Сделал обработку что указывается общий вес товаров в печатной расходной накладной. Вес товара берется из карточки товара. В случае если вес там не указан он считает его за 0 и всё равно выдает общий вес товара, что неправильно по сути. Пытаюсь сделать так что бы у меня выводило в накладной на что не указан вес. Получается сделать так с одной позицией, но т.к это цикл при наличии двух товаров без указанного веса в карточке, последний товар просто заменяет первый и показывается только один товар без веса. Пытался присвоить НетВеса=НетВеса+Строка.Номенклатура, но так не получается. Уверен что всё просто, но для новичка как я - это безумие.
Прикрепленные файлы:
По теме из базы знаний
Найденные решения
7. jmw 61 04.06.24 05:16 Сейчас в теме
можно так
Прикрепленные файлы:
Остальные 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. nomad_irk 76 03.06.24 09:44 Сейчас в теме
(1)Вывод общего веса нужно за цикл вынести - как минимум.
5. Sashares 35 03.06.24 10:45 Сейчас в теме
(1)Неужели самому нормально читать такой код? В чем сложность выравнивание использовать?
6. VPanin56 549 03.06.24 19:05 Сейчас в теме
(1)Для правильного сложения строковых значений да еще и вместе с числовыми используйте функцию СтрШаблон()

Например СтрШаблон(" Не указан вес: %1",Строка.Номенклатура)
3. VZyryanov 03.06.24 09:51 Сейчас в теме
НетВеса = "";
перенесите туда же, где
Вес1 = 0;
4. Vlan 36 03.06.24 10:36 Сейчас в теме
Можно сделать массив номенклатуры, у которой нет веса. Потом соединить значения в строку.
Можно в текстовую переменную добавлять:
НетВеса=НетВеса+"; "+Строка.Номенклатура.Наименование;
7. jmw 61 04.06.24 05:16 Сейчас в теме
можно так
Прикрепленные файлы:
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от